PROSNOW, a novel climate service enabling real-time optimization of snow management in mountain ski resorts
PROSNOW is a prediction model for meteorological and snow conditions in ski resorts. It enables real-time optimisation of grooming and snowmaking in ski resorts, thereby supporting their activities under increasingly challenging operating conditions due to climate change.
